How does gardening make people happy?

Gardening has been proven to have numerous physical and mental health benefits. It's a great way to stay active and get some exercise, whether it's pruning, planting, or weeding. Not to mention, the fresh air and sunshine can do wonders for our mood and overall well-being.

But gardening isn't just about physical health. It also has a positive impact on our mental health. Engagement in gardening has been shown to promote social relationships, family connection, emotional and mental well-being, and reduce stress, anxiety, and depression. It can provide a sense of accomplishment and purpose, as well as a connection to nature. In addition, there's nothing quite like the satisfaction of watching your plants grow and thrive under your care.
